Excursion d'une demi-journée d'observation des baleines au départ de Monterey

Aperçu
Embark on a 4-hour whale watching tour. All trips are narrated by a naturalist or marine biologist guide, who will also spend one on one time with guests while on deck. Professional photographers are often sent to capture the spectacular sights seen from on board and are available to offer tips for your own photography.

Information additionnelle
  • Not recommended for pregnant travelers
  • Service animals allowed
  • Public transportation options are available nearby
  • Travelers should have at least a moderate level of physical fitness
  • Children must be accompanied by an adult
  • Minimum drinking age is 21 years
  • Warm layers are recommended
  • Sun protection, camera, binoculars, water, and snacks are recommended
  • If prone to motionsickness, please take precautionary measures and we also sell motion sickness remedies in the shop

We saw 23 Gray Whales and 20+ dolphins on a beautiful March day! The waters were choppy, if you get seasick you absolutely need to take something! Pack layers, it was 55 degrees and sunny, but on the water it was significantly colder.
